It operates from an input voltage range of 2.25V to 5.5V and provides a regulated output voltage from 0.8V to 5V while deliver- ing up to 3A of output current. The internal synchronous power switch with 77mΩ on-resistance increases efficiency and eliminates the need for an external Schottky diode. Switching frequency is set by an external resistor or can be synchronized to an external clock. 100% duty cycle provides low dropout operation extending battery life in portable systems. OPTI-LOOP® compensation allows the transient response to be optimized over a wide range of loads and output capacitors. The LTC3412A can be configured for either Burst Mode operation or forced continuous operation. Forced continu- ous operation reduces noise and RF interference while Burst Mode operation provides high efficiency by reducing gate charge losses at light loads.
